What are some common challenges trade assistants face during large-scale construction projects?

Trade Assistants often encounter challenges such as adapting to rapidly changing work priorities, coordinating with multiple trades on-site, and maintaining safety standards in busy environments. They may need to quickly learn new tasks or tools to support different trades, which requires flexibility and a willingness to ask questions. Effective communication and teamwork are crucial, as Trade Assistants frequently collaborate with skilled tradespeople, site supervisors, and other assistants to ensure smooth workflow and project progress.

The main difference between a Trade Assistant and a Labourer lies in their roles and responsibilities. Trade Assistants support skilled tradespeople with specific tasks, often requiring some industry-specific training or certifications. Labourers perform general manual labor without specialized skills, focusing on physical tasks. Both roles are essential in construction and related industries, but Trade Assistants typically work more closely with tradespeople and may have more targeted training.

What does a trade assistant do?

A Trade Assistant supports skilled tradespeople, such as electricians, plumbers, or carpenters, by performing a variety of tasks on job sites. Their duties often include preparing and cleaning work areas, fetching tools and materials, assisting with basic tasks, and ensuring safety protocols are followed. Trade Assistants help improve efficiency and productivity, making it easier for tradespeople to focus on specialized work. The role often serves as an entry point for those interested in building a career in the trades.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a trade assistant?

To thrive as a Trade Assistant, you need a basic understanding of construction or trade practices, physical fitness,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with hand and power tools, as well as adherence to workplace safety systems like PPE protocols, is typically required. Strong teamwork, reliability, and the ability to follow instructions set outstanding Trade Assistants apart. These skills ensure safe, efficient support for tradespeople and contribute to smooth site operations.

Job description

Trading Assistant
Who we are:
Pharo Management is a leading global macro hedge fund with a focus on emerging markets. Founded in 2000, the firm has offices in London, New York, Hong Kong and Abu Dhabi, and currently manages $8 billion in assets across four funds. Pharo trades foreign exchange, sovereign and corporate credit, local market interest rates, commodities, and their derivatives. We trade in over 70 countries across Asia, Central and Eastern Europe, the Middle East and Africa, Latin America as well as developed markets. Our investment approach combines macroeconomic fundamental research and quantitative analysis.
Pharo employs a diverse, dynamic team of 140 professionals representing over 20 nationalities and 30 languages. We have a strong corporate culture anchored in core values such as collaborative spirit, creativity, and respect. We are passionate about what we do and are committed to attracting the best and brightest talent.
This is a great opportunity to join a market leader and contribute to our continued success.
Job description:
We are looking to hire a Trading Assistant who will help to bridge the working relationship between the Portfolio Management Team and Execution Team. The successful candidate will:
  • Ensure trades are captured accurately by internal risk systems. Capture end of day risk and ensure trade blotter is clean and that all trades are booked.
  • Collaborate with operations team to ensure smooth settlement of all trades.
  • Aid in Portfolio management bookkeeping tasks to limit residual interest rate and FX risk.
  • Control the futures' delivery process to ensure Portfolio Managers are trading the current, most liquid futures contracts.
  • Manage NDF fixing risk.
  • Aid with PnL reconciliation for Fixed Income, FX, and Interest Rate focused strategies.
  • Work in close integration with software development team to optimize Pharo's start to finish trading processes.
